I find it interesting that Horizon claims that their infant formula is
"completely adequate to support normal infant growth" compared to breast
milk when the study shows that this product actuallly produces LARGER
infants than breastfed infants. If breastfed babies are the norm then how
can they conclude  that their product "supports normal infant growth"?
Shouldn't they say instead that their product results in "larger than
normal" infants?

They sound as though they are playing into parents' misinformed hopes for
"bigger = better and healthier" babies.
